Der Rabbi von Bacherach, by Heinrich Heine. Berlin: Euphorion, 1921.
Five woodcuts by Joseph Budko, accompanying Heinrich Heine's story written following the 1840 Damascus Blood Libel. Frontispiece woodcut signed in pencil. Initial letters and title page (woodcut) designed by Budko as well. Numbered copy, 232/320.
88, [2] pp, 18 cm. Good condition. Stains. Upper gilt edges. Binding with leather spine and corners, damaged.
